Q: Is 5,851,113 a Prime Number?
A: No, 5,851,113 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 5851113 can be evenly divided by 1 3 307 921 6,353 19,059 1,950,371 and 5,851,113, with no remainder.
Since 5,851,113 cannot be divided by just 1 and 5,851,113, it is not a prime number.
